Transaction 59db24204d71222f028220a85c1c0540cca2a4ef48a7d3dd92ee638e0df72f91

1 Input
2 Outputs
  • 59db24204d71222f028220a85c1c0540cca2a4ef48a7d3dd92ee638e0df72f91:0
  • value  450013
    address  16YzctT8RDAT7KAmXCfseksaJycnp3pHig
  • 59db24204d71222f028220a85c1c0540cca2a4ef48a7d3dd92ee638e0df72f91:1
  • value  4966679
    address  1Go8Kd6LpJs6VnkUW4yBUcNFUL2RBeM4ki